The Ring War Saga began as a friendly chat between Sargatanus, Cicion and Darkk about the Salrilian menace. I'm not sure how it was suggested, but it was decided to do something about it. Sundered Angel came up with the plan, which was modified slightly to suit the mission requirements. Then all mercenaries availible were called into the battle, where Slug's Home Armada clashed with the invading fleets. The Angel fighter wing, captained by El Spamo, struck a crippling blow, and was guided to a wormhole by Sundered Angel as the wrathful Salrilians turned on them.

About that point, the Ring exploded.

I'd say that's a fair summary of how it went, no?
